Hi guys i just bought myself a set of used long tube 351w hooker swap headders. I have 2 questions if i may since these are not new so i don't know if this is right.

Some of the primary tubes can be removed. also the flange for the headder is not one piece. Its split in some spots.

Is it surpose to be that way. If so y? Are your surpose to weld the tubes that can pull out once installed? Sry for the newbie question.

Second they came with like i'd say a 1/4 steel gasket. Will my stock headder bolts work? Or do i need a longer set?
I hope someone can chime in. I hope i didn't buy a bunk set of headders.
Will any xpipe bolt up to these headders as well?>

they are made that way to help with install of them DONT WELD THEM.. does the 1/4 plate have any extra holes in it? they do that when you run the bigger tube headers to change the bolt pattern to the make more room for the bigger tubes and make getting to the bolts easier. and more then likely you will need to make your own X pipe so it will fit on the collectors or mod the thing up to have ball type ends. I just made ours so it just slides up on the headers then put a band clamp on it it comes on and off in like 10 mins.

with the tubes that slide out most of the time they have a small clamp or the end of tube has a place to put a small bolt to help them seal up.
The headers I had cut the sealing ball type flange off and welded a pipe on and then just slide The X pipe over the end of the headers clamped with band clamp. that was the old set up so I have no Pics. it is now a turbo car and has only one down pipe the X now just slides up on the down pipe and the other side is just capped off same set up just one pipe to hit.
Yes the plate would mount like you said as far as gaskets that depends on how good of shape every thing is in..

I use Hooker Super Comps on mine with no problems. On the tubes with the slip fit joints, use a good coat of anti seeze on them. This makes them slid together easier, and after a few good heat cycles, forms a gasket like seal. No leaks.
